The jacket with a hat veil is the single most critical piece of protective equipment because honey bees are biologically programmed to target the face of mammalian intruders. This behavior is triggered by carbon dioxide (CO2) receptors on the bees' antennae, which allow them to detect your exhalations and perceive you as a predator.
Protective gear serves as a barrier against venom, but the veil specifically counters the bee's evolutionary instinct to attack the source of breath. By neutralizing this specific trigger, the veil prevents dangerous stings to sensitive areas like the eyes, nose, and mouth.
The Biological Mechanism of Aggression
The CO2 Trigger
Bees possess highly sensitive CO2 receptors located on their antennae. They utilize these receptors to pinpoint the location of a threat based on the concentration of carbon dioxide in the air.
Because humans exhale CO2, your breath acts as a homing beacon for guard bees. Without a veil, your face becomes the primary target for their defensive behavior.
The "Bear" Defense Mechanism
This aggressive response to CO2 is an evolutionary adaptation developed to defend colonies against predators, specifically bears.
Bears breathe heavily when attacking a hive to steal honey. Consequently, bees have evolved to aggressively sting the areas where CO2 is most concentrated—the nose and eyes—to drive the predator away.
Debunking the "Sensing Fear" Myth
It is a common belief that bees can "sense fear," but this is technically inaccurate. They are actually reacting to fear-related behaviors.
When a person is nervous or afraid, they tend to breathe more heavily or rapidly. This releases larger amounts of CO2, which the bees detect and respond to with increased aggression.
Managing Safety and Venom Risks
Protection Against Apitoxin
Honey bees deliver apitoxin (bee venom) when they sting. The physical reaction to this venom varies wildly from person to person, ranging from mild irritation to dangerous swelling.
Because the face and neck are highly vascular and sensitive, stings in these areas are not only painful but can cause swelling that may obstruct vision or breathing.
Disruption Causes Reaction
The very act of opening a hive disrupts the colony's environment. This makes the bees naturally more prone to stinging than they would be while foraging.
The jacket and veil provide a necessary shield for the torso, arms, and head, protecting you during these moments of inevitable agitation.
Establishing Tolerance
For new beekeepers, wearing full protective gear is essential while determining personal tolerance to bee venom.
You cannot know how your immune system will react to multiple stings until it happens. The gear allows you to learn proficient handling techniques without the risk of a severe medical emergency during the learning curve.
Understanding the Trade-offs
Comfort vs. Protection
The primary trade-off with heavy protective gear, such as a full jacket and veil, is heat and physical restriction. Beekeeping often happens in warm weather, and layers of protective fabric can become uncomfortable.
Dexterity Limitations
While the jacket and veil protect the core and head, full suits often include gloves which can limit tactile feedback.
Some experienced beekeepers may choose to work without gear to improve dexterity and comfort. However, they accept a higher risk of stings, relying on their ability to read bee behavior rather than physical barriers.
Making the Right Choice for Your Goal
Whether you choose a full suit or just a jacket and veil depends on your experience level and comfort with risk.
- If your primary focus is safety and learning: Prioritize a high-quality jacket with a secure veil to eliminate the risk of facial stings while you master hive mechanics.
- If your primary focus is comfort during quick inspections: You may eventually transition to lighter gear, but never compromise on the veil due to the bees' instinctive attraction to CO2.
Ultimately, the veil is not just clothing; it is the only effective countermeasure against a honey bee's 30-million-year-old instinct to attack your breath.
